数据库在电脑上编程实践指南365


什么是数据库?

数据库是一种组织和管理大量数据的系统。它允许用户存储、检索和操作数据,同时确保数据的一致性和完整性。

数据库在计算机编程中的应用

数据库在计算机编程中扮演着至关重要的角色,因为它可以:

存储和管理应用程序数据
执行数据操作,例如插入、更新、删除和检索
提供数据安全性、完整性和一致性

在计算机上对数据库进行编程

要在计算机上对数据库进行编程,需要遵循以下步骤:

1. 选择数据库管理系统 (DBMS)


DBMS是与数据库交互的软件。它提供创建、管理和操作数据库所需的功能。常见的 DBMS 包括 MySQL、PostgreSQL、Oracle 和 Microsoft SQL Server。

2. 创建数据库连接


在编程语言中,需要创建一个对象来连接到数据库。每个 DBMS 都有自己的连接语法。

3. 执行数据操作


使用 SQL(结构化查询语言),可以执行对数据库的各种操作,例如:

CREATE:创建新表
INSERT:在表中插入数据
UPDATE:更新表中的数据
DELETE:从表中删除数据
SELECT:从表中检索数据

4. 处理查询结果


执行 SQL 查询后,会返回一个查询结果集。程序需要解析结果集并提取所需的数据。

5. 关闭数据库连接


使用完数据库后,需要关闭连接以释放资源。

示例代码

以下是一个使用 Java 连接到 MySQL 数据库并执行查询的示例代码:```java
import .*;
public class DatabaseExample {
public static void main(String[] args) {
// JDBC 驱动类名称
String driverClassName = "";
// 数据库 URL
String url = "jdbc:mysql://localhost:3306/database_name";
// 数据库用户名
String username = "username";
// 数据库密码
String password = "password";
try {
// 加载 JDBC 驱动
(driverClassName);
// 创建数据库连接
Connection connection = (url, username, password);
// 创建 SQL 语句
String sql = "SELECT * FROM table_name";
// 创建 Statement 对象
Statement statement = ();
// 执行 SQL 语句
ResultSet resultSet = (sql);
// 遍历查询结果
while (()) {
// 获取结果
int id = ("id");
String name = ("name");
// 输出结果
("ID: " + id + ", Name: " + name);
}
// 关闭结果集
();
// 关闭 Statement
();
// 关闭连接
();
} catch (ClassNotFoundException e) {
();
} catch (SQLException e) {
();
}
}
}
```

通过在计算机上编程数据库,程序员可以管理和操作大量数据。通过遵循上面概述的步骤和使用适当的编程语言,开发人员可以创建功能强大且高效的数据库应用程序。

2025-01-18


上一篇:天津市电脑编程课程大纲

下一篇:使用苹果电脑编程好吗?